Book 10, Hollow Lives, was released in July last year. Sadly, that didn't give me enough room to finish book 11 before Christmas. Still working on that one but very nearly done.

Hollow Lives tells the story of Dr Abigail Darius, a physics prof. who finds a way to detect membrane universes. With her funding cut off (no obvious cash benefits!) and with the help of her husband, she continues her investigations at home. Everything changes when someone in another universe responds to her call.

On average, I write around 1,000 words a day. Sometimes more. I complete a chapter roughly every two weeks. Book 11 is so far at 16 chapters. I think another 1 or 2 at most will do it. Of course, then I have to put the whole lot together, format it, and then go through it from cover to cover to make sure I've not said something that I contradicted later. It then goes out, in sequence, to two more editors to try and catch the stupid mistakes. Some still get through despite six editors, and me, repeatedly, trying to catch them all, but the bulk are caught. What's left isn't even spotted by most readers. I re-read, spot them, beat myself up, and fix them.
